Abstract

Kiris coastline, located in the west of Antalya, is one of the important tourism regions. Rocks of different ages and characteristics of the region are observed in the sediments of the coastline. The aim of the study is to determine the anomaly areas of Kiris beach sediments by calculating different indices such as contamination factor (Cf), degree of contamination (Cd), modified contamination degree (mCd), pollution load index (PLI) and enrichment factor (EF). The beach sediments taken systematically along the beach were chemically analyzed by X-ray fluorescence spectroscopy (XRF). In this context, accumulation index degrees were determined in the study area and anomaly areas caused by natural and anthropogenic effects were determined.
